If the STC fitting failed it will allow oil to escape from the high pressure oil system and trip an ICP code, the truck will shut down because the injectors are starved of oil. Same thing mine did, I was stranded in Tuscaloosa, AL for 3 days. It may start back up when it cools down and everything contracts, but who knows how far it will get you. Mind you this is just my best guess from my past experience.

if its the stc fitting, it's not a serviceable part. ford has an updated stc fitting. also, while ur in there, change out the dummy plugs / standpipes. they'll last longer too.

when the original stc fitting leaks, they usually crack apart. when i took my hpop out, the stc fitting didnt even need to be removed. it jus fell apart cos it cracked. poor manufacturing. lousy part. new one is a clear difference and much better too.

it maintains oil pressure a lot better too.
